Phase diagram of disordered spin-Peierls systems
Maxim Mostovoy, Daniel Khomskii, Jasper Knoester
Abstract
We study the competition between the spin-Peierls and the antiferromagnetic ordering in disordered quasi-one-dimensional spin systems. We obtain the temperature vs disorder-strength phase diagram, which qualitatively agrees with recent experiments on doped CuGeO3.
